由于一开始也没重视这个考试,基本上没有准备,考试前一天才看题目,学了几个小时把大纲过了一遍就去参加考试了。结果因为下午学习犯困喝了咖啡一晚上没睡着(想死),今天还下大雨,头晕眼花的考完试。感觉成绩很暧昧,在及格线附近。还是建议大家提前去备考,科班的同学提前半个月时间备考是完全没问题的,每天学习3-4小时,大纲内容挺多但是考的都不难。选择题去微信上找一个小程序刷题就完事了,大题就c语言算法和java比较难,java必须把面向对象的重要知识掌握,比如封装、继承、多态、抽象在题目中都会有体现。还有就是方法的调用,谁调谁的方法等等,c语言算法考的无非就是那几种算法(选择,冒泡,插入,快速,归并等等)。
一、考试内容
考试内容主要包括以下几个方面:
- 软件设计基础知识:
-
- 计算机科学基础
- 数据结构与算法(选择题这部分不到10分,大题15分)
- 软件工程基础(考点很多重点)
- 数据库系统原理(选择题考的不多,大题15分)
- 操作系统原理(原理性知识点,背就完事了)
- 软件架构设计:
-
- 软件体系架构设计
- 分布式系统设计
- 系统集成设计
- 安全与可靠性设计
- 软件过程管理:()
-
- 软件开发过程管理
- 软件配置管理
- 软件项目管理
- 软件质量管理
- 软件度量与评估
- 软件设计模式:
-
- 面向对象设计模式
- 基于组件的软件设计模式
- 面向服务的软件设计模式
- 软件测试与质量保障:
-
- 软件测试方法与技术
- 质量保障体系与方法
- 软件性能测试与优化
- 软件需求分析与设计:
-
- 需求工程与需求分析
- 软件设计方法与思想
- 软件界面设计
- 软件体系结构设计
- 软件工程项目管理:
-
- 软件项目计划与进度管理
- 项目风险管理
- 软件过程改进与度量
- 项目组织与沟通管理
二、考试科目与题型题量
考试科目包括综合知识(基础知识)和软件设计(应用技术)两部分:
- 综合知识:
-
- 题型:75道单项选择题
- 答题形式:机考
- 满分:75分
- 合格标准:国家标准为45分
- 软件设计:
-
- 题型:6道大题(只做5道),前4道必答(数据流图、数据库设计、UML建模、C语言算法),后2道二选一(JAVA语言程序设计或C++语言程序设计)
- 答题形式:机考
- 满分:每题15分
- 合格标准:45分